What It Is
A custom cursor frame that snaps or eases around interactive targets, making selectable elements feel physically acquired.
Decision Guidance
Use Target Cursor Lock for experiential hover targeting; use Focus Ring Highlight for normal product guidance.
Best For
Making a small set of large interactive targets feel precise and game-like.
Avoid When
Avoid it for productivity interfaces where a custom cursor slows users down.
Timing
150-300ms lock movement; the frame should feel attached, not laggy.
Easing
Use a spring or fast ease-out with mild damping.
Risk Tags
✓When to Use
- Game-like menus
- Creative portfolios
- Spatial interfaces where hover targeting is part of the experience
✕When NOT to Use
- Standard forms and dashboards
- Touch-first interfaces
- Any UI where replacing the cursor hurts usability
Configuration Tips
- 01Keep the native pointer semantics intact
- 02Only lock onto large targets with clear hover states
- 03Disable for coarse pointers and reduced motion

Code Example (Tailwind CSS)
A focused implementation sketch you can adapt to your product state.
'use client';
import { useState } from 'react';
export function TargetCursorFrame() {
const [active, setActive] = useState(0);
const items = ['Docs', 'Billing', 'Team'];
return (
<div className="relative inline-flex gap-3 rounded-2xl border border-stone-200 bg-white p-3">
<div className="pointer-events-none absolute top-3 h-12 w-24 rounded-xl border-2 border-amber-400 transition-transform duration-200 ease-out" style={{ transform: `translateX(${active * 108}px)` }} />
{items.map((item, index) => (
<button key={item} onMouseEnter={() => setActive(index)} className="relative h-12 w-24 rounded-xl bg-stone-50 text-sm font-medium text-stone-700">
{item}
</button>
))}
</div>
);
}Related Effects
